MÁNCHESTER, Inglaterra (AP) — Arsenal pasó 248 días como líder de la Liga Premier inglesa la temporada pasada.
Aun así terminó con las manos vacías. El domingo por la noche podría volver a erigirse en la cima de la máxima categoría inglesa y enviar un mensaje enfático en el proceso. Arsenal recibe en el Emirates Stadium al campeón Manchester City, en un duelo entre el primer y segundo lugar de la temporada pasada, que será visto como una prueba temprana de las credenciales de título de los londinenses.
En la temporada anterior, Arsenal perdió los tres enfrentamientos ante el equipo del español Josep Guardiola, dos veces en la liga y una en la Copa de la FA. En esos tres partidos recibió ocho goles y anotó dos. Esos seis puntos obtenidos en los dos duelos de liga fueron la diferencia en la carrera por el título. El City terminó 5 puntos por delante.
